Fire Suppression Liquids Formula

\n

Fire Extinguishing Agents ¥ Escape Sprays ¥ Throw Bottles

\n

This Fire Suppression Liquids Formula book covers the formulation and production of portable, non-pressurized liquid fire extinguishing agents designed for initial fire suppression and emergency escape assistance. The products discussed are ready-to-use, water-based liquids, packaged in handheld containers suitable for spraying, pouring, or throw-bottle application.

\n

Unlike conventional fire extinguishers that rely on compressed gas, propellants, or pressure vessels, these systems operate through direct liquid application. Fire suppression is achieved by rapid heat absorption, flame inhibition, and short-term surface protection, allowing temporary control of early-stage fires.

\n

The formulations presented in this book are primarily aqueous systems, incorporating inorganic fire-retardant components and functional additives engineered to:

\n \n
    \n
  • \n

    Reduce flame intensity

    \n
  • \n
  • \n

    Lower surface and flame-zone temperatures

    \n
  • \n
  • \n

    Delay re-ignition after initial knockdown

    \n
  • \n
  • \n

    Create a short-duration suppression window to support safe evacuation

    \n
  • \n
\n

These products are not intended for sustained firefighting operations and are not replacements for certified industrial or fixed fire suppression systems. Their primary role is initial intervention, fire intensity reduction, and escape facilitation during incipient fire scenarios.

\n

This book is written for manufacturers, chemical formulators, private-label brands, and fire safety product developers seeking practical, formulation-level guidance rather than theoretical fire science or marketing content.
